Scripting Weblog

むたぐち(牟田口大介)が、Windows上で動作するスクリプティング環境(Windows PowerShell、IronPython、Windows Script Host(WSH)、HTML Application(HTA)、Windowsサイドバー ガジェットetc)に関するニュースやサンプルコードなどを紹介します。

ホーム 連絡をする 同期する ( RSS 2.0 ) Login
投稿数  201  : 記事  1  : コメント  437  : トラックバック  41

ニュース

2009/10/17 このブログのミラーを作りました
2009/7/30 共著「PowerShellによるWindowsサーバ管理術」発売!
2009/7/1 MSMVP for PowerShell再受賞!
拙著「Windows PowerShellポケットリファレンス」2008/4/11に発売になりました!
自宅Webサーバー「winscript.jp」本格稼働

自己紹介

ライター兼プログラマでMSMVP for Data Center Management - PowerShell のむたぐち(牟田口大介)です。

MVP Logo

Microsoft MVP for Visual Developer - Scripting July 2004-June 2007
Microsoft MVP for Data Center Management - PowerShell July 2007-June 2010

広告

書庫

日記カテゴリ

My Sites

コミュニティ

Windows Server 2008 R2ではPowerShell v2が標準機能ですが、v2の目玉の一つとしてリモートでサーバーのPSを実行できる機能があります。

詳しくは、7/4の大阪のセッションでデモを交えてお話しできると思いますが、http://technet.microsoft.com/ja-jp/magazine/2008.08.windowspowershell.aspxを読んで予習しておくのもいいかと思います。

なお、この記事が書かれたときの最新バージョンのCTP2から変更点があり、コマンドレット名が若干変わっています。

New-RunSpace→New-PSSession

push-runspace→Enter-PSSession

pop-runspace→Exit-PSSession

さて、PSRemotingはWinRM2.0を用いたリモート通信なのですが、WinRM2.0は認証にKerberos認証を用います。Active Directoryにログオンしたクライアントから

New-PSSession ServerName

のようにすると、ログオン時の認証情報が用いられ、認証され、通信が始まります。しかし、ログオン時とは異なる認証情報を送る必要がある場合もあるので、そのときは-credentialパラメータを使います。

New-PSSession ServerName -credential (Get-Credential)

のようにすると、認証ダイアログが表示されるので、ユーザー名とパスワードを入れて認証情報を送りログオンすることができます。

投稿日時 : 2009年6月30日 23:23

コメント

No comments posted yet.

Post Feedback

タイトル
名前
Url:
コメント: